EIB and BIIC Launch €100 Million Initiative to Boost Benin's Agricultural Supply Chains
The European Investment Bank (EIB) and the Banque internationale pour l’industrie et le commerce (BIIC) have initiated a €100 million financing facility to enhance agricultural supply chains in Benin. This initiative, supported by the European Commission, aims to strengthen sectors such as cotton, soya, and cashew, which are crucial for both Benin's economy and European markets. The facility is part of the EU's Global Gateway strategy, which seeks to improve infrastructure and supply chains globally. The program also includes a technical assistance component to support sustainable finance and ESG assessment.
